Raytheon is rolling out new generation air and missile defense radars, SPY-6, onto US Navy ships, differing from the existing SPY-1 radars. The SPY-6 radars are part of the US Navy's efforts to modernize its defense systems. This upgrade aims to enhance the navy's air and missile defense capabilities.
The introduction of SPY-6 radars is significant for the US Navy's defense capabilities, offering improved detection and tracking of airborne and missile threats. This technology upgrade is crucial for maintaining the navy's operational effectiveness in evolving threat environments.
